Defensive organisation is paramount in tournament football. Teams that reached the latter stages of World Cup 2022 often showcased exceptional defensive structures. We can compare their solidity through various lenses, including how technology influences their defensive shape and decision-making. While traditional methods focus on man-marking, zonal coverage, and disciplined positioning, modern approaches integrate GPS tracking for player stamina management, heatmaps to identify defensive gaps, and even video analysis tools that dissect opposition attacking plays in microscopic detail. This allows for a more proactive rather than reactive defensive posture. For instance, a team might use analytics to predict the most dangerous zones an opponent targets and pre-emptively reinforce those areas, a strategy far more sophisticated than simply reacting to an attack as it unfolds. This contrasts with teams whose defensive frameworks might be less adaptable due to a reliance on less data-intensive methods.

Consider the offensive output. While aggregate statistics like goals scored can be tracked easily, understanding the *quality* of chances created is where technology shines. Modern analytics can differentiate between a speculative long shot and a high-probability scoring opportunity generated through intricate passing sequences or well-executed pressing traps. This granular detail helps coaches make more informed decisions, shaping training regimes and match-day tactics. The comparison here is stark: one approach relies on observable outcomes, while the other dives deep into the predictive science behind those outcomes, offering a more robust framework for sustained excellence. Data-Driven Scouting & Recruitment
Utilises advanced analytics to identify potential talent based on statistical profiles and performance metrics, often identifying undervalued players or predicting future success. This contrasts with traditional scouting, which relies more on human observation and established reputations.
In-Game Tactical Adjustments
Employs real-time data feeds to adjust formations, pressing intensity, and player roles based on opposition patterns and in-game statistics. This is a more dynamic, responsive approach compared to pre-match tactical plans that are adhered to rigidly, often seen in teams with less technological integration.
Player Performance Monitoring
Integrates wearable technology and sophisticated biomechanical analysis to monitor player fatigue, injury risk, and optimal performance load. This allows for precise training load management, contrasting with traditional methods that might rely on subjective player feedback or less granular physical assessments.
